# SQL Linting — Onboarding Notes

All SQL files in the Quillbase repo pass through `sqlcheck` before merge. Rules cover keyword casing, explicit column lists, and a ban on `SELECT *` outside scratch directories. The linter runs in CI and locally via the pre-commit hook; install it with `make hooks`. Rule overrides require a comment referencing the exception log. The linter also validates migration files against the schema registry, which requires an access token set in your `.env` file on the following line:

sealed setting: VAULT_KEY13=741e0a90de233

**Ticket: Config drift on BounceSift processor**

The email bounce processor in the Larkfield environment has drifted from the values committed in the release branch. Retry windows and suppression thresholds no longer match, which likely explains the duplicate suppression entries reported Tuesday. Please reconcile before the Thursday cut. For reference, the currently deployed configuration on the live node reads as follows.

config for yajep-yahof:
[briax]
port = 9200
region = outer-2
host = briax.nelvrocorp.test
team = raleth
timeout_ms = 1500
retries = 1

Runbook: Cold Storage Archival. Buckets in the Larkspur tier untouched for 180 days are candidates for archival. Verify the retention tag, snapshot the manifest, and confirm no active restore jobs reference the bucket before moving it to glacier-class storage. Reversal takes up to 48 hours. The step-by-step archival procedure is documented on the page below.

runbook for tafof-yawif: https://confluence.tolvaqsys.internal/display/display/browse/pages/7be3

**Q3 Planning Note – Logistics Switch**

Heads up, everyone: we're moving from Tarnwick Freight to Oslerline at the end of the quarter. Better coverage in the eastern corridor and fewer missed slots, per the pilot. Expect a bumpy two weeks during handover — flag issues to Deya early. There's one more thing you should know.

board note of bajop-yaweg: The western region missed its Pelys quota by 58.0 percent last quarter. Pelysek Foods plans to raise the Belius list price by 44.0 percent in July. The steering committee signed off on a budget of $133.8 million for Project Pelax. The renewal with Zoraelix Systems closes at $61.9 million a year, 12.7 percent above the last contract.